1. What is cloud computing recruitment in Luxembourg?
Cloud computing recruitment in Luxembourg involves hiring skilled IT professionals who design, deploy, manage, and secure cloud infrastructure used by financial institutions, fintech companies, international corporations, and technology service providers. Employers recruit cloud engineers, cloud architects, DevOps specialists, and cloud security professionals to support scalable enterprise systems and digital transformation strategies.
2. Why is there a demand for cloud computing professionals in Luxembourg?
Demand for cloud computing jobs in Luxembourg is driven by the country’s strong financial services industry, fintech innovation, data centre infrastructure, and the rapid adoption of cloud platforms such as AWS,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ud by international companies operating in Luxembourg.

5. Do foreign cloud computing specialists need a work permit in Luxembourg?
Yes. Non-EU nationals typically require a Luxembourg work permit and residence permit before starting employment. Highly skilled professionals may qualify for EU Blue Card schemes if salary thresholds and qualifications are satisfied.
6. Is formal education required for cloud computing jobs in Luxembourg?
Most employers prefer candidates with degrees in computer science, information technology, cloud computing, or software engineering. However, strong experience with cloud platforms, infrastructure automation, and DevOps tools may also be considered valuable.
7. How long does the Luxembourg work permit process take?
Processing times vary depending on documentation, employer sponsorship procedures, and immigration processing by national authorities. Employers must secure official employment authorisation before foreign professionals begin working legally.
8. Is French, German, or English language knowledge required?
English is widely used in the technology and financial sectors. Knowledge of French or German may be beneficial depending on the organisation and workplace environment.

12. Are cloud technologies regulated in Luxembourg?
Yes. Cloud systems must comply with EU data protection regulations, such as the GDPR, and financial-sector cybersecurity standards, particularly for institutions handling sensitive financial and enterprise data.
13. Do cloud professionals receive social security benefits in Luxembourg?
Yes. Legally employed cloud computing professionals contribute to Luxembourg’s social security system, which includes healthcare coverage, pension contributions, and employment protection benefits.
14. Are cloud computing salaries competitive in Luxembourg?
Yes. Cloud computing professionals in Luxembourg typically earn between €5,000 and €10,500 per month,h depending on experience, certifications, and technical responsibilities.

17. Are DevOps and cloud automation skills important?
Yes. Skills in Kubernetes, Docker, Terraform, CI/CD pipelines, containerisation, and infrastructure automation are highly valued by Luxembourg’s technology and fintech employers.
18. Are international cloud certifications recognised in Luxembourg?
Yes. Certifications such as AWS Certified Solutions Architect, Microsoft Azure Solutions Architect, Google Cloud Professional Architect, and Kubernetes certifications are widely recognised by employers.

20. Can cloud computing professionals change employers in Luxembourg?
EU nationals may change employers freely. Non-EU nationals must ensure compliance with the conditions of their work and residence permits when changing employment.
21. Can cloud computing professionals bring family members to Luxembourg?
Eligible residence permit holders may apply for family reunification if they meet income, accommodation, and immigration requirements.
